The Professional Capabilities Framework (PCF) is a supporting structure that helps both aspiring and qualified social workers think about the skills, knowledge, and values they use in their practice. The child in need process is underpinned by section 17 of the Children Act 1989.This states that a local authority's initial role is to support the children and their families, facilitating them to remain a family unit and therefore reducing the need for compulsory action. Student PCF level descriptors for pre-qualifying levels of social work and ASYE: entry level, readiness for direct practice, end of first placement, end of last placement/completion and newly qualified social worker (ASYE level). Knowledge 6. pcf domains for social work students examples. They are specialist to the social work profession and apply to registered social workers in all roles and settings. Then at each level within the PCF, detailed capabilities have been developed explaining how social workers should expect to evidence that area in practice. The social work reform board developed the professional capabilities framework (PCF) to provide foundations for social work education and to support development after qualification.
